Bruce SCHMITT Obituary

SCHMITT, Bruce Owen

passed away Wednesday, January 16, 2019, at the age of 75. Bruce was raised in Union, New Jersey, the son of Anton and Rose (Wohlfarth) Schmitt. He spent the later part of his life in retirement in Spring Hill, Florida. A long-time employee of Supermarkets General, Bruce worked his way up from 'cart boy' to a corporate management position. He was also a member of the Union Township Special Police, holding the rank of Sergeant upon retiring from the force. Bruce was a classic car and motorcycle enthusiast and was active in many clubs and organizations over the years, including a longtime membership in the Galloping Hill Cruisers and a 30-plus year member of the Blue Knights organization. He also enjoyed traveling the country by motorhome, having visited nearly every state in America over his lifetime as part of the El Dorado camping club. Having lost his wife, Cindy, to cancer in 2000, Bruce found a second chance at love with his longtime partner, Teresa Douthit, who along with her children, will miss him greatly. Bruce is survived by his two loving daughters, Theresa Schmitt and Lorraine Silvestro; and his seven adoring grandchildren, Ryan, Nicholas, Isabella, Chelsea, Christopher, Joseph, and Chase.
